[The donation system (also known as donation) can also be commonly known as buying official positions and selling titles! ]
[People often regard this phenomenon as the root cause of corruption and chaos in the government! It is really unacceptable! ]
[But in fact, this system has a much longer history than China's imperial examination system! ]
[Donations already existed during the Warring States Period! ]
[Until the fall of the Qing Dynasty, for thousands of years, it had always been considered an important auxiliary means of the court's finances! ]
[The earliest trace back to the pre-Qin period, in 243 BC, due to a locust plague, the then Qin Shi Huangdi Ying Zheng issued an order that "the people would be awarded a rank of nobility if they paid dan of millet." ]
[Later, during the reign of Emperor Wen of the Han Dynasty, Chao Cuo's suggestion was adopted, and the emperor issued an edict, "Anyone who plants grain on the border will be granted the title of Shangzao, Wudafu, etc."]
【Zhang Shizhi, Sima Xiangru and others were also promoted to court officials through this path. 】
[During the reign of Emperor Wu of Han, the title of military merit was established, attracting a large number of salt and iron merchants. ]
【After the chaos and mourning, the treasury of the Later Wei Dynasty was empty, so he implemented the system of selling titles in exchange for grain to ease the financial problem.】
[During the Tang and Song dynasties, whenever there was a disaster, the imperial court implemented a policy of providing official positions with grain in order to reduce the financial burden on the country.]
